Dynamic Eye Contact System

The most critical interaction mechanic revolves around line of sight. The artificial intelligence governing the creature is hyper-sensitive to the player's gaze. Establishing eye contact triggers one of three distinct behavioral responses, none of which are fixed, adding a layer of chaos to every encounter:

  • The Feigned Retreat: The entity may rapidly flee upon being spotted. While this offers a momentary relief, it is often a tactical deception rather than a sign of fear, lulling the player into a false sense of security before a subsequent ambush.
  • The Stare Down: In a deeply unsettling scenario, the creature will crouch and lock eyes with the player. This creates a paralyzing moment of tension where the outcome is unknown, forcing the player to question their next move while under direct observation.
  • The Aggressive Charge: The most dangerous reaction involves the entity sprinting at full speed toward the player immediately after visual contact is made. In confined spaces like narrow mineshafts or base hallways, this leaves little room for error or escape.

Attempting to avoid looking at the monster is not a viable long-term strategy. Even a fleeting glance or accidental peripheral vision can trigger the event chain, making navigation through dark areas a test of nerve.

Verticality and Environmental Interaction

Experienced players often rely on verticality as a primary defense mechanism, building pillars or retreating to high ground to evade ground-based threats. The CANTBREATHE Mod: Atmospheric Horror and Unpredictable Threat counters this tactic effectively. The entity possesses the ability to perform significant vertical leaps, allowing it to reach players who believe they are safe on elevated platforms or rooftops. This capability forces a reevaluation of base design and emergency escape routes. Relying solely on height is no longer sufficient; players must incorporate blocked exits, trapdoors, and redundant escape paths into their architecture to survive an assault.

Version-Specific Limitations and Balance

When deploying this mod, it is crucial to understand version-specific behaviors that affect game balance. Specifically, in the Minecraft 1.20.1 environment, the entity is programmed not to break blocks. This limitation alters the defensive meta significantly. While your walls and fortifications remain structurally intact against this specific threat, the danger shifts to open-field engagements and staircase confrontations where physical barriers cannot be erected instantly. Players planning their campaigns on this version should focus on mobility and line-of-sight management rather than purely static fortification.

Technical Requirements and Installation

To ensure the mod functions correctly, particularly regarding the fluid animations and complex model rendering of the creature, there is a strict dependency. The installation of GeckoLib is mandatory. Without this library, the entity may fail to load, appear as a missing texture, or exhibit broken animation states, ruining the immersive horror experience.
